First off, let's talk about what a boxes gluing machine is and why you might need one. A boxes gluing machine is a piece of equipment used to glue the flaps of cardboard boxes together. It's a crucial part of the packaging process, especially for industries that rely on a large number of boxes, like e - commerce, food, and consumer goods. There are different types of these machines, such as the Automatic Carton Folder Gluer Machine, Automatic Box Gluing Machine, and Automatic Carton Gluing Nailing Integrated Machine. Each type has its own features and is suitable for different production needs.
Now, back to the MOQ. The minimum order quantity for purchasing a boxes gluing machine can vary widely depending on several factors.


1. Machine Type
Different types of boxes gluing machines have different production costs and manufacturing complexities. For example, a basic automatic box gluing machine might have a lower MOQ compared to a more advanced automatic carton gluing nailing integrated machine. The latter is a more sophisticated piece of equipment that combines gluing and nailing functions, which means it requires more parts, more precise engineering, and more labor to produce. So, generally, if you're looking at a simpler machine, you might be able to get away with a smaller order. A basic machine could have an MOQ of 1 - 2 units, while a high - end integrated machine might have an MOQ of 3 - 5 units.
2. Customization
If you need a customized boxes gluing machine, the MOQ is likely to be higher. Customization means that the manufacturer has to deviate from the standard production process. They might need to design new parts, adjust the software, or make other modifications. All these extra steps increase the cost and time of production. For instance, if you want a machine with a specific speed, size, or function that's not available in the standard models, the manufacturer will have to invest more resources. In such cases, the MOQ could be 5 - 10 units or even more, depending on the level of customization.
3. Production Capacity
Our production capacity also plays a role in determining the MOQ. If we have a lot of free production slots and are looking to fill them, we might be more flexible with the MOQ. On the other hand, during peak production seasons or when we have a high demand for our machines, we might need to set a higher MOQ to make the production process more efficient. For example, if we're swamped with orders for other machines and only have a limited amount of time to produce your boxes gluing machine, we might require you to order at least 5 units to make it worth our while.
4. Market Demand
The market demand for the boxes gluing machine you're interested in can affect the MOQ. If a particular type of machine is in high demand, the manufacturer might be less willing to accept small orders. They'd rather focus on fulfilling large orders to maximize their profits. Conversely, if a machine has low market demand, the manufacturer might be more open to accepting smaller orders to move the inventory.
Advantages of Meeting the MOQ
Meeting the minimum order quantity can actually bring you some benefits. First of all, you're likely to get a better price per unit. When you order in larger quantities, the manufacturer can spread the fixed costs (such as setup costs, tooling costs) over more units, which reduces the cost per machine. This means you'll save money in the long run.
Secondly, a larger order can ensure a more stable supply. If you need a continuous supply of boxes gluing machines for your business expansion or to meet your production needs, a larger order can guarantee that you have enough machines on hand. You won't have to worry about running out of machines and facing production delays.
What if You Can't Meet the MOQ?
If you can't meet the MOQ, don't worry. There are still some options available. You can try to negotiate with the supplier. Explain your situation, such as your budget constraints or your short - term production needs. Sometimes, the supplier might be willing to make an exception, especially if they see potential for a long - term business relationship with you.
Another option is to team up with other buyers. You can find other companies or individuals who are also interested in buying boxes gluing machines and place a joint order. By combining your orders, you can meet the MOQ and still get the machines you need at a reasonable price.
